LeCoultre Futurematic 'Porthole'

Wow, this is a rare one! The futurematic model was made from 1952 (one of the first fully automatics) until 1958. Most were sold in the USA under the LeCoultre name but the most rare of all is this model, the so-called 'Porthole'. The movement is very special as well as setting the time is done at the caseback... because of this a regular crown is not needed and the design is very clean! This example is one of the best I ever saw, super minty! The original dial has raised pink-gold indexes and hands. The steel case with ref E502 measures 37mm. Movement is Cal 817/1 (no picture as opening it is something a watchmaker should do;). Attached is a very nice croco strap which matches perfectly.
